The temperature of a piece of metal was 32°C. It was then lowered into a glass of
Paul [167]

Answer:

12.5%

Step-by-step explanation:

Given that,

Initial temperature of a piece of metal = 32°C

Final temperature of the piece of metal = 36°С

We need to find the percentage increase in the temperature of the piece of metal.​ The percentage increase in any value is given by the relation as follows :

\%=\dfrac{|\text{final value-initial value}|}{\text{initial value}}\times 100\\\\=\dfrac{36-32}{32}\times 100\\\\=12.5\%

So, the required percentage increase in the temperature of the piece of metal is equal to 12.5%.
